ORIGINAL: BleedinBlue

I'm amazed how cheap those spoilers are...I'm still used to the new edge Terminator spoilers that everyone tries to get their hands on that are $400 or so USED.

I know it HAD to have been explained...but heres a S197 noob question. If I were to switch from the stock spoiler to the GT500 spoiler...what would be the deck lid hole situation? Would the GT500 use ANY existing holes, would any holes be left uncovered, and would I HAVE to drill new holes?
Depends if u buy it from the ebay spoiler store which only uses two of the four existing holes!!
But if u buy the real shelby one which is way more expensive it uses all four holes!!
Ebay = 125.00 painted and shipped
Shelby= 260.00 + shipping and UNPAINTED
Make your choice
